Abstract :
This paper reports the use of suspended gate SG-MOSFET transistor for oscillator applications. The SG-MOSFET is analyzed as a vibrating-gate structure and a small-signal equivalent circuit is proposed and validated. An adapted 16 MHz oscillator topology is demonstrated.
